Raphael PichonAbout
A world removed from the grand and awesome visions of the Last Judgement that so often characterise settings of the Mass for the Dead, Brahms conceived a work of ‘consolation for those who are suffering’.
Having spent more than ten years absorbing this German ‘humanist’ Requiem, this album’s performers have meticulously shaped every bar of this compact work, achieving a form of polyphonic transparency that confounds the senses and transcends the universality of its message.
